Johnson Metal Works is a rapidly growing Bozeman-based metal fabrication company specializing in O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) and Architectural projects. We are currently seeking experienced, enthusiastic and dedicated full-time welders/fabricators to join our team and contribute to our dynamic architectural projects.
Job DescriptionAs a Field Installer in the Architectural Metals department, you will be responsible for the successful installation of architectural metal components such as paneling, railings, stairs, fireplaces, kitchen hoods and more. This role requires a strong work ethic, dependability, and the ability to adhere to tight tolerances on reveals, plumb, square, and other critical measurements. This role is ideally suited for individuals with a background in finishes and high-end construction, including finish carpenters, counter top installers, and glaziers.
